- Abstract
The text explores the environmental and economic impact of Israel's actions against Palestinians in Gaza and the West Bank. It highlights the uprooting of native olive trees, the use of illegal white phosphorus, and the potential exploitation of the region for oil drilling. The public health situation in Gaza is dire, with an increase in respiratory and waterborne illnesses. The text also discusses the limited mainstream reporting on this issue. Additionally, it touches on the incident of offensive emails sent by an assistant district attorney in San Francisco, anti-Arab sentiment in law enforcement, and the impact of climate change in Southern California.
